Abstract
Na obravnavanem območju, ki obsega območje Slovenske Istre, Krasa in Brkinov z dolino reke Reke, se upravljavci vodovodnih sistemov srečujejo s težavo zagotavljanja zadostnih količin pitne vode. V Slovenski Istri je primanjkuje predvsem zaradi dejavnosti turizma, ki pa spada v gospodarski sektor. Pitna voda za prebivalstvo ima prednost pred drugimi rabami, vendar je prebivalstvo v regiji finančno odvisno od turizma, zato je tudi za prebivalce pomembno zagotavljanje količin vode sektorju turizma. Poleg omenjenega se regije srečujejo s pomanjkanjem rezervnih vodnih virov. Ker je bilo opravljenih že veliko študij v zvezi z razpoložljivostjo vodnih količin v Obalno – Kraški regiji, sem sama izbrala pogled na težavo iz drugega zornega kota. Vodooskrbne sisteme sem obravnavala z vidika razmejevanja obveznosti med lokalno skupnostjo in Republiko Slovenijo pri izvajanju nalog v zvezi z oskrbo s pitno vodo. Pred izdelavo variantne analize sem pregledala značilnosti oskrbe s pitno vodo v Sloveniji, teoretične podlage za oskrbo s pitno vodo, rabo vode v Sloveniji ter na obravnavanem območju, zakonske okvirje za oskrbo s pitno vodo, geografske značilnosti območja, obremenjenost voda ter podatke o porabi vode in vodni bilanci vseh treh vodovodnih sistemov. S pomočjo variantne in SWOT analize sem prišla do spoznanja, da je najbolj ugodna situacija delitve nalog pri oskrbi s pitno vodo tista, pri kateri imamo na območju koncesionarja, kateri opravlja vse obveznosti v zvezi z vodooskrbo.

Title:Allocation of obligations for drinking water supply between the Republic of Slovenia and the local communities
Abstract:
In the presented academic work I study the allocation of obligations between the Republic of Slovenia and the local communities for drinking water supply in the regions of Slovenska Istra, Kras and Brkini with Reka valley. Rižanski vodovod Koper, Kraški vodovod Sežana and Komunala Ilirska Bistrica are public companies that provide the water supply in the area of study. Their main water sources are Rižana, Brestovica and Bistrica. The regions are dealing with the problem of lack in water quantities, especially in the summer months. Because Rižanski vodovod Koper has to buy the missing quantities of water from the neighboring water sistems, it faces the most critial problems with water supply. A problem of the sudied water sistems is also the provision of spare water sources, that represent one of the basis for quality water supplies. Many different studies were made, with the intent of sloving the water problems, but none of them were realised. This time, I decided to look at the problem from a different point of view, a way that allocates obligations between the local community and the Republic of Slovenia. Based on the results of SWOT and GIS analysis, I can claim that the best option for future water supply would be option C. In this case is the water supply manegement entirely under the responsibility of the Republic of Slovenia.
